Skottie Young (born March 3, 1978) is an American comic book artist, children's book illustrator, and writer. He is famous for his work with many Marvel Comics characters. Skottie Young is also known for his comic book versions of L. Frank Baum's Oz books. He worked on these with Eric Shanower. Another popular series he created is I Hate Fairyland. He also worked on a series of novels with Neil Gaiman called Fortunately, the Milk.

Skottie Young's Amazing Career

SY Headshot-2413-2
Skottie Young in 2019

Skottie Young moved to Chicago in 2000 from Tennessee. Around this time, he started working for Marvel Comics. His first projects included drawing the Spider-Man Legend of the Spider Clan mini-series. This was part of the Marvel Mangaverse. He also worked on Human Torch and New X-Men. He even wrote one issue for New X-Men.

Drawing for Marvel Comics

Young drew a six-issue New Warriors mini-series. It came out in June 2005. Zeb Wells wrote this series. It showed the team as stars of a reality TV show.

He has drawn covers for many comic books. These include Cable & Deadpool, Spider-Man, Deadpool, and Iron Man. He also created a very popular series of "Baby Variant" covers. These covers featured baby versions of Marvel heroes.

Oz Books and Rocket Raccoon

Skottie Young received great praise for his work on The Wonderful Wizard of Oz. This series became a New York Times Best Seller. It also won an Eisner Award. Marvel Comics published this series. He and Eric Shanower adapted five more books from the Oz series.

Young wrote and drew a Rocket Raccoon solo series for Marvel Comics. It started in July 2014. This series came out before the Guardians of the Galaxy movie. Young said he wanted the series to feel like old Looney Tunes cartoons. He liked how those cartoons were not always "squeaky clean." He enjoyed bringing that fun style to a superhero universe.

Creating I Hate Fairyland

From October 2015 to July 2018, Young wrote and drew I Hate Fairyland. This was a comic book series he created himself. Image Comics published the series. He drew the first 20 issues.

In 2018, Marvel launched new titles as part of their Fresh Start plan. Skottie Young became the writer for Deadpool. In June 2019, Marvel Comics released a book called The Marvel Art Of Skottie Young.

In August 2021, Young started a newsletter on Substack. There, he announced that I Hate Fairyland would be coming back. Future issues of the series will be written by Young. Brett Parson will draw them. Other side stories will be released first on Young's Substack. Later, they will be published more widely.

Skottie Young's Personal Life

Skottie Young lives in Prairie Village, Kansas. He lives there with his wife, Casey McCauley. They have two children.
